Re: Attackers getting past IPTables
Posted: 2019/05/21 22:12:54
by TrevorH
If you're running CentOS 7 then the default firewall is firewalld. That runs all the time and watches the running rules and will promptly change them back to how it thinks they ought to be so if you are running your script on a system using firewalld and not iptables-services then your newly added rules are probably immediately deleted.

Re: Attackers getting past IPTables
Posted: 2019/05/22 14:50:25
by TrevorH
The reason we prefer iptables-save over iptables -L is because of that confusion: the "Accept all" mentioned above as causing the issue is actually
iptables -A INPUT -i lo -j ACCEPT
so is not the problem.
Yes, tcpdump sees packets before they hit iptables so you see rejected or dropped traffic in tcpdump output. Once it hits iptables it gets dropped. You can use iptables -nvL to see the packet and byte counters and see that your rules are being hit.
